Hawthorn has made one change for its final game of the year against Geelong this Saturday night at GMHBA Stadium.

Ruck Tamara Luke has been recalled her first match since Round 6, as she prepares to play her final career game alongside Akec Makur Chuot before they both farewell the AFLW.

Luke's selection will see Sophie Locke miss the clash, with the youngster omitted for the Pride Round fixture.

The Hawks will again be wearing their 2023 Pride Guernsey, inspired by Hawthorn duo Tilly Lucas-Rodd and Louise Stephenson.

Hawthorn General Manager of Football Operations Max Bailey was looking forward to ending the season on a high note.

"We have a lot to play for as a club on Saturday night, with every match another opportunity to improve and develop," Bailey said.

"Having Tam and Akec play their final games while celebrating Pride Round will also be a big occasion and we hope to make our members and fans proud.

"We're also excited about the opportunity to face Geelong for the first time and extend the storied rivalry in the men's competition to the AFLW."
